Uses of Interface
com.hazelcast.spi.merge.SplitBrainMergePolicy
Packages that use SplitBrainMergePolicy
Package
Description
This package contains interfaces and classes of the split-brain merging SPI.
-
Uses of SplitBrainMergePolicy in com.hazelcast.spi.impl.merge
Classes in com.hazelcast.spi.impl.merge that implement SplitBrainMergePolicyModifier and TypeClassDescriptionclasscom.hazelcast.spi.impl.merge.AbstractSplitBrainMergePolicy<V,T extends MergingValue<V>, R> Abstract implementation ofSplitBrainMergePolicyfor the out-of-the-box merge policies. -
Uses of SplitBrainMergePolicy in com.hazelcast.spi.merge
Classes in com.hazelcast.spi.merge that implement SplitBrainMergePolicyModifier and TypeClassDescriptionclassDiscardMergePolicy<V,T extends MergingValue<V>> Merges only entries from the destination data structure and discards all entries from the source data structure.classExpirationTimeMergePolicy<V,T extends MergingValue<V> & MergingExpirationTime> Merges data structure entries from source to destination data structure if the source entry will expire later than the destination entry.classHigherHitsMergePolicy<V,T extends MergingValue<V> & MergingHits> Merges data structure entries from source to destination data structure if the source entry has more hits than the destination one.classOnly available for HyperLogLog backedCardinalityEstimator.classLatestAccessMergePolicy<V,T extends MergingValue<V> & MergingLastAccessTime> Merges data structure entries from source to destination data structure if the source entry has been accessed more recently than the destination entry.classLatestUpdateMergePolicy<V,T extends MergingValue<V> & MergingLastUpdateTime> Merges data structure entries from source to destination data structure if the source entry was updated more frequently than the destination entry.classPassThroughMergePolicy<V,T extends MergingValue<V>> Merges data structure entries from source to destination directly unless the merging entry isnull.classPutIfAbsentMergePolicy<V,T extends MergingValue<V>> Merges data structure entries from source to destination if they don't exist in the destination data structure.Fields in com.hazelcast.spi.merge with type parameters of type SplitBrainMergePolicyModifier and TypeFieldDescriptionprotected final Map<String,SplitBrainMergePolicy> SplitBrainMergePolicyProvider.mergePolicyMapprotected static final Map<String,SplitBrainMergePolicy> SplitBrainMergePolicyProvider.OUT_OF_THE_BOX_MERGE_POLICIESMethods in com.hazelcast.spi.merge that return SplitBrainMergePolicyModifier and TypeMethodDescriptionNamespaceAwareSplitBrainMergePolicyProvider.getMergePolicy(String className, String namespace) Resolves theSplitBrainMergePolicyclass by its classname within the specified namespace.SplitBrainMergePolicyProvider.getMergePolicy(String className) Resolves theSplitBrainMergePolicyclass by its classname using the application class loader.SplitBrainMergePolicyProvider.getMergePolicy(String className, String namespace) Resolves theSplitBrainMergePolicyclass by its classname using the application class loader.